The road to success for Olympic athlete and American half-marathon record holder Ryan Hall has been paved with countless miles—and way more failures than successes. But surprisingly, he wouldn’t have it any other way. In fact, Ryan says every challenge and disappointment was pivotal in his journey to become one of the greatest long-distance runners in the world.
